Implemented checker/unit test for various operations.
Rationale:
It's test time! These new checker tests verify that various
common integer operations are recognized as intrinsic.
Furthermore, some functionality testing is done to ensure
that architectural specific implementations are correct.

+public class Main {
+
+ /// CHECK-START: int Main.sign32(int) intrinsics_recognition (after)
+ /// CHECK-DAG: <<Result:i\d+>> InvokeStaticOrDirect intrinsic:IntegerSignum
+ /// CHECK-DAG: Return [<<Result>>]
+ private static int sign32(int x) {
+ return Integer.signum(x);
+ }
+
+ /// CHECK-START: int Main.sign64(long) intrinsics_recognition (after)
+ /// CHECK-DAG: <<Result:i\d+>> InvokeStaticOrDirect intrinsic:LongSignum
+ /// CHECK-DAG: Return [<<Result>>]
+ private static int sign64(long x) {
+ return Long.signum(x);
+ }
+
+ public static void main(String args[]) {
+ expectEquals(-1, sign32(Integer.MIN_VALUE));
+ expectEquals(-1, sign32(-12345));
+ expectEquals(-1, sign32(-1));
+ expectEquals(0, sign32(0));
+ expectEquals(1, sign32(1));
+ expectEquals(1, sign32(12345));
+ expectEquals(1, sign32(Integer.MAX_VALUE));
+
+ for (int i = -11; i <= 11; i++) {
+ int expected = 0;
+ if (i < 0) expected = -1;
+ else if (i > 0) expected = 1;
+ expectEquals(expected, sign32(i));
+ }
+
+ expectEquals(-1, sign64(Long.MIN_VALUE));
+ expectEquals(-1, sign64(-12345L));
+ expectEquals(-1, sign64(-1L));
+ expectEquals(0, sign64(0L));
+ expectEquals(1, sign64(1L));
+ expectEquals(1, sign64(12345L));
+ expectEquals(1, sign64(Long.MAX_VALUE));
+
+ for (long i = -11L; i <= 11L; i++) {
+ int expected = 0;
+ if (i < 0) expected = -1;
+ else if (i > 0) expected = 1;
+ expectEquals(expected, sign64(i));
+ }
+
+ System.out.println("passed");
+ }
+
+ private static void expectEquals(int expected, int result) {
+ if (expected != result) {
+ throw new Error("Expected: " + expected + ", found: " + result);
+ }
+ }
+}
